Stephen A. Smith breaks down his list of the top five 3-point shooters in NBA history and JJ Redick is mostly in agreement.
1. Steph Curry
2. Ray Allen
3. Klay Thompson
4. Reggie Miller
5. Kyle Korver

    Oh how quickly people forget about Steve Nash. A four-time member of the 50 40 90 club, and would have had a fifth time if he would have shot .1% higher free throw percentage in 06-07. He has nine seasons of shooting over 40% from the 3-point line and his career average 3-point percentage is 42.8% . He just didn't shoot them as frequently because he was a pure point guard but do not mistake that for his undeniable shooting prowess. He is undoubtedly in my opinion a top five shooter of all time.

    Kyle Korver was also a very underrated screener. He didn't just curl around screens in a floppy set. He set them, too. Especially in Atlanta, you'd often see him set a pick up top to create two options: either roll and use another off-ball pick to get open towards the wings or corners, or simply pop and fire from the top of the arc.
